[RTFACT-15498] Access client in Artifactory cannot recover from key revocation done in Access Server Created: 19/Dec/17  Updated: 26/Sep/18  Resolved: 01/Feb/18

Status: Resolved
Project: Artifactory Binary Repository
Component/s: Access Client, Access Tokens
Affects Version/s: 5.6.0, 5.7.0, 5.6.1, 5.6.2, 5.6.3
Fix Version/s: 5.9.0

Type: Bug Priority: High
Reporter: Dan Feldman (Inactive) Assignee: Tamir Hadad
Resolution: Fixed Votes: 0
Labels: None

Issue Links:
Assigned QA: Dudi Morad (Inactive)
Sprint: Leap 28


To reproduce:

  • revoke keys in Access (using the reset_root_keys marker for instance)
  • Access goes up, regenerates new keys
  • Artifactory goes up, during the wait for access phase it will fail ping with 401 (because currently saved admin token is invalid)
  • Instead of going through a client bootstrap which will invalidate the admin token we fail and Artifactory will be left in an inconsistent state, unable to communicate with Access,

Generated at Sun Jan 19 11:44:14 UTC 2020 using JIRA 7.6.16#76018-sha1:9ed376192612a49536ac834c64177a0fed6290f5.